Trail Overview

Maige Branch, also known as Apalachicola National Forest Road 313B, connects Cow House Bay at the north end and the Ranger trail at the south end. It takes you through the northeast part of the Apalachicola National Forest along the Cow Swamp and gives you access to a few OHV and Off-road trails. It is definitely one of the more technically challenging trails in the area. You'll find several permanent Mud Holes that are up to 4 feet deep and several hundred feet long with very slick mud. You can get easily stuck on this very narrow trail. The road is not wide enough for two vehicles to pass. 4WD and high clearance is required. All vehicles must be street legal. Please be aware that the cellphone reception is weak. The Apalachicola National Forest is located in the eastern part of Florida's panhandle. Difficulty

Mud Holes can be up to 500 feet long and 3-4 feet deep. Do not approach without recovery gear or a second vehicle.
